What are Sr Controls Engineers?

Sr Controls Engineers are experienced professionals who design, develop, and maintain control systems used in manufacturing, automation, or other industrial processes. They work with hardware and software to ensure machinery operates efficiently, safely, and according to specifications. Their responsibilities often include programming PLCs, troubleshooting system issues, leading projects, and collaborating with multidisciplinary teams. Senior-level controls engineers also mentor junior staff and contribute to the strategic improvement of automation processes.

What is the difference between Sr Controls Engineer vs Controls Engineer?

AspectSr Controls EngineerControls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Electrical, Mechanical, or related engineering; often 5+ years experience; certifications like PLC or automation certificationsBachelor's in relevant engineering; 1-3 years experience; similar certifications
Work EnvironmentIndustrial plants, manufacturing facilities, automation projectsSimilar industrial settings, project-based work, automation systems
Employer & Industry UsageManufacturing, automation, process control industriesManufacturing, industrial automation, equipment design

The main difference between a Sr Controls Engineer and a Controls Engineer lies in experience level, responsibilities, and expertise. Sr Controls Engineers typically have more years of experience, handle complex automation projects, and may mentor junior staff. Controls Engineers are often earlier in their careers, focusing on implementing and maintaining control systems. Both roles are vital in industrial automation and share similar work environments and industry applications.

Overview

We are seeking a Senior Controls Engineer with deep expertise in HVAC controls, Building Automation Systems (BAS/BMS), and Energy Management Systems (EMS) to support a large-scale entertainment and facilities environment.

This role is heavily focused on design, commissioning, and long-term sustainment of building systems across a complex campus. You will play a critical role in optimizing system performance, leading field investigations, and supporting ongoing operations of HVAC and facility automation systems.


Key Responsibilities
  • HVAC Controls Engineering & Commissioning: Lead hands-on troubleshooting, commissioning, and optimization of HVAC and building automation systems across a large campus environment.

  • BAS/BMS System Design & Sustainment: Design, enhance, and support BAS/BMS infrastructure, including system architecture, sequences of operation, and long-term system performance.

  • Energy Management & Optimization: Support EMS platforms, analyze system trends, and implement improvements to increase energy efficiency and operational reliability.

  • Field Diagnostics & Technical Leadership: Perform advanced field investigations, root cause analysis, and system diagnostics; lead complex troubleshooting efforts.

  • Controls Software & Visualization: Develop and optimize system interfaces including GUIs, dashboards, alarming, and reporting tools for facility systems.

  • Controls Documentation & Standards: Own technical documentation including schematics, wiring diagrams, panel layouts, and sequences of operation throughout system lifecycle.

  • System Integration: Integrate BAS/BMS platforms with enterprise analytics, monitoring, and reporting systems.

  • Panel Design Oversight (UL508A): Support or oversee control panel design ensuring compliance with UL508A and electrical standards.

  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ner with engineering, IT, facilities, and vendors to deliver system improvements and capital projects.

  • Mentorship & Guidance: Provide technical leadership and mentorship to engineers and operations teams.
